Committee of National Unity : ウィキペディア英語版 | Committee of National Unity The Committee of National Unity (Spanish: ''Comité de Unidad Nacional'', CUN) was a right-wing self-styled "technocratic" organization of moderate conservative business and government leaders〔Political handbook of the world 1981. New York, 1981. P. 70.〕 in Bolivia. The CUN was founded by Hernán Antelo Laughlin, Fastón Villa and Renald MacLean in November 1977. 〔Rolando Pereda Torres. Partidos políticos en América Latina. CIEPSAL, 1986. P.111.〕 In 1978 the Committee of National Unity took part in an electoral coalition Nationalist Union of the People backing Juan Pereda Asbún. 〔George E. Delury. World Encyclopedia of Political Systems & Parties: Afghanistan-Mozambique. Facts on File, 1983. P.103.〕 In 1979, the CUN dissolved into Hugo Banzer Suárez's new Nationalist Democratic Action (ADN). ==Notes==
